A significant body of research has been devoted to pinpointing and cataloguing the binding sites of RNA-binding proteins (RBPs) on target transcripts. The most common techniques involve crosslinking and immunoprecipitation (CLIP) followed by high-throughput sequencing. In this review, we provide a comprehensive summary of the major advancements in CLIP-based techniques and state-of-the-art data analysis methods designed for identifying and analysing the binding sites of RBPs. We also brief on methods used to determine the functional relevance of these binding sites and, in addition, delve into the major hurdles faced in the detection and elucidation of the binding sites of RBPs. Finally, we explore reproducibility concerns in the CLIP field, and conclude by suggesting potential avenues for future improvements.
